Reference is made to the notice for an extraordinary general meeting in Dolphin Group published on 20th October 2011.

The nomination committee proposes that Ms. Eva Kristensen is elected as a new board member in the company.  

Ms. Kristensen has more than 20 years of experience from the oil and gas industry. She has worked for different companies delivering service and equipment to the oil companies, such as Aker Subsea, Aker Process Systems, Aker Drilling Risers and GE Oil & Gas. In addition she has worked four years as a sales director for the IT company, Atea. Ms. Kristensen is today managing director at GE Oil & Gas' (former Vetco) Nordic. Ms. Kristensen has served as board member for companies such as Pertra ASA (now Det Norskeoljeselskap ASA), Kværner Oil Field Products AS and Kværner Energy AS.

Dolphin Group ASA has two main business areas; Dolphin Geophysical AS and Dolphin Interconnect Solutions AS. Dolphin Geophysical is a global full-range, asset light supplier of marine geophysical services and operates a fleet of new generation, high capacity seismic vessels and offers contract seismic surveys and multi-client projects worldwide. Dolphin Interconnect is a global supplier of high performance solutions (hardware- and software) for the server and embedded systems market. Dolphin Group ASA is listed at Oslo Stock Exchange (OSE ticker: DOLP).
